1 dead in Independence single-car crash
KANSAS CITY, Mo. - One person is dead after a single-car crash in Independence, Missouri. It happened around 11:45 p.m. Sunday night on Blue Ridge Boulevard at 30th Street on the west side of the city.

Chiefs beat Broncos: 12 winners and 12 losers
The Kansas City Chiefs beat the Denver Broncos, 30-23, on Sunday to improve to 7-1 on the season. Here are the winners and losers from Sunday's game: I believe it is already safe to call Chiefs quarterback Patrick Mahomes elite, and though I realize that is still a subjective take, an objective fact is that Mahomes is officially among elite company after his four touchdowns Sunday make it 26 total on the season.
